I am getting some upholstery work done on my rear seat and the ski locker cover, so when I took all of that apart, I uncovered the ballast tanks. My curiosity got to me, so I took out my tape and measured them. Each tank is about 8" tall, 10" wide, and 60" long. This ends up being 4800 cu.in, which is about 21 gallons each. And 42 gallons of water is right around 350 pounds. So do we have different tanks? Or are the tanks not uniform enough in shape fo my measuring to be accurate? Either way, if I subtract that from the max load capacity, that leaves 1000-1100 pounds. Add say 4 people for at least 600 pounds and at least 100 pounds for gear and and cooler and such. I am left with only about 300-400 pounds of ballast that I can add. Well, at least I am just a beginner wakeboarder and I still love to slalom ski, so it's not a big deal yet.
